Blessed with a dynamic singing voice and an exciting stage presence, Cheri delights in a Gospel music thrust at concerts and special events to present the Word of God to her audience. Before becoming a solo performer and recording artist, she traveled with a local Gospel group in her home area of Santa Claus, Indiana. As a soloist, Cheri has won three Gospel talent searches and has had considerable national radio airplay with her music. Her latest recording project, Sing Hallelujah, is a collection of songs ranging from the beautifully arranged “God’s Great Love” to the bouncy, exciting “Trumpet of Jesus”. Familiar songs from the hymnal are here along with brand new music from some of today’s most talented writers. |

Preacher - Dr Russell Kidman Dr. Russell Kidman was deployed to Operation Desert Shield and Operation Desert Storm during the Liberation of Kuwait in 1990-1991. He was a Sergeant serving as a Fire direction NCO and secondary Chemical Specialist for Alpha Battery 2nd Battalion 29th Field Artillery Unit. They were deployed as General Support Reinforcement to 42nd Brigade and 3rd Armor Division under General Tommy Franks. Brother Kidman and his wife have a firsthand understanding of what the Soldier who is deployed as well as their family who is left behind are experiencing. Most people see the Soldier coming home but fail to realize the struggles of returning home and readjusting to civilian life and family. This is where Brother Kidman applies his experience and knowledge of God’s Word to help our Soldiers and their Families from a Biblical perspective. |
